Problem #7: An LC circuit is made by attaching a 150-turn solenoid of length 0.75 m and diameter 10 cm
to a capacitor of unknown capacitance C. The resulting current, I, as a function of time, t, flowing
through the inductor is plotted in the graph below.

a). What is the inductance, L, of the solenoid inductor?
b). At time t = 1.5 seconds, how much energy is stored inside the inductor?
c). What is the capacitance C of the unknown capacitor?
d). At time t = 3.5 seconds, how much energy is stored inside the capacitor?
